|
|
|
Почетна >> Странице предметa >> Интеграција софтверских технологија |
|
|
|
О предмету |
Интеграција софтверских технологија |
Студијски програм: Нове рачунарске технологије, Нове рачунарске технологије - на даљину |
|
Назив предмета: Интеграција софтверских технологија |
|
Наставник:
др Зоран Ћировић |
|
Статус предмета: Изборни |
|
Шифра предмета: |
|
ЕСПБ бодови: 6 |
|
Услов: Познавање основних појмова из програмирања и Интернета |
|
Циљ предмета: Циљ наставе је оспособљавање студената да пројектују и пишу делове интегрисаних система коришћењем савремених технологија. |
|
Исход предмета:
На крају одслушаног предмета студенти ће бити оспособљени да уз помоћ савременог развојног окружења развију комерцијалне интегрисане системе, да програмирају мрежне системе и користе скрипт језике. |
|
Садржај предмета:
Теоријска настава: |
- Архитектуре интегрисаних система.
- Опис технологија DCOM, CORBA, RMI и њихова примена.
- Мрежно програсмирање, сервиси за рад са порукама и редовима.
- Метаподаци, презентација података и кодирање.
- XML, DTD, XML шеме, парсирање XML докумената.
- XSL, XSLT и Xpath технологије и трансформација низова података.
- Узорци дизајна: MVC, observer, singleton, factory.
- Интерфејси и наслеђивање.
- Скрипт језици и њихова могућа улога, коришћење скрипт језика.
- Различите технологије безбедности и њихове карактеристике.
- Потврда системских ресурса и сервиса.
- Заштита података у комуникацији између система и сервиса.
- Историја програмских језика, програмске парадигме.
- Ефекти скалирања, виртуелне машине.
- Језици са компајлирањем и интерпретирањем. Апликације или скрипт језици
|
Практична настава: |
Практична настава прати програм предавања и одвија се демонстрирањем комерцијалних апликација применом наведених технологија.
Програм предмета усклађен са препорукама IEEE/ACM Computing Curriculum IT2005 Information Technology Body of Knowledge:IT-IPT1-7 |
|
|
Литература: |
- Николић, Бошко, Програмирање графичких апликација, ФПИ, Београд, 2006.
- Michael J. Young, XML Корак по корак, ЦЕТ, Београд, 2005
|
|
Број часова активне наставе: 75
|
|
Остали часови: |
|
Предавања: |
Вежбе: |
Други облици наставе: |
Студијски и истраживачки рад: |
2 |
3 |
|
|
|
|
Метода извођења наставе:
Предавања, вежбе, консултације, семинарски радови и писмени испит и усмени испит. |
|
Оцена знања (максималан број поена 100):
Предиспитне обавезе |
Поена |
Завршни испит |
Поена |
активности у току предавања |
|
писмени испит |
60 |
практична настава |
10 |
усмени испит |
|
семинарски рад |
30 |
испит за рачунаром |
|
колоквијум |
|
практичан |
|
|
|
|
|
|
|
|